Background
A base station, i.e. a public mobile communication base station, is an interface device for a mobile device to access the internet, and is a form of a radio station, which is a radio transceiver station for information transmission with a mobile phone terminal through a mobile communication switching center in a certain radio coverage area. The construction of mobile communication base stations is an important part of the investment of mobile communication operators, and is generally carried out around the factors of coverage, call quality, investment benefit, difficult construction, convenient maintenance and the like. With the development of mobile communication network services toward datamation and packetization, the development trend of mobile communication base stations is also inevitably to make the mobile communication base stations broadband, large coverage area construction and IP. With the gradual development of communication technology, in order to improve the signal quality of mobile phones, communication base stations are often arranged on the ground; the communication base station is provided with an antenna, and the antenna can receive signals sent by the mobile phone and send the signals to other base stations or the mobile phone to realize the transmission of the signals.
Because the structure of basic station antenna is similar with trees, consequently often have the bird to stay on the antenna, bird excrement and urine covers the antenna and influences the antenna function easily on the one hand, often has birds on the other hand antenna to build the nest, and the activity of birds can lead to the fact the influence to signal base station to influence people's normal communication.

Example 1: referring to fig. 1, the present invention provides a technical solution: a base station antenna structure with a bird repelling function for electronic information engineering comprises an upright post 1, an antenna body 2 and a bird repelling structure, wherein the upright post 1 is cylindrical, the antenna body 2 is installed on the upright post 1 through an antenna installation part 3, and the bird repelling structure is arranged at the end part, close to the antenna body 2, of the upright post 1; the bird repelling structure comprises a bird repelling plate body 4, a bird repelling ball 6 and a bird repelling device 7, wherein the top of the bird repelling plate body 4 is provided with a driving thorn 41, and the end part of the bird repelling plate body, which is close to the antenna body 2, is provided with a connecting pipe 42; connecting pipe 42 is the shape of cooperating with stand 1 and its and stand 1 cooperation, connecting pipe 42 passes through locking bolt fixed suit at the 1 top of stand, connecting pipe 42 with drive bird plate body 4 and be connected, its suit is at the 1 top of stand, can overlap connecting pipe 42 on stand 1 when the bird structure is driven in the installation, and it is fixed with stand 1 through locking bolt, and when driving the bird structure in the dismantlement, can realize dismantling driving the bird structure with connecting pipe 42 and stand 1 separation, the installation is dismantled conveniently.
In this embodiment, drive bird ware 7 and set up a plurality ofly and it is the polyhedron shape, drive the surface of bird ware 7 and paste a plurality of reflectors, a plurality ofly drive bird ware 7 and connect through lifting rope 8 respectively and drive bird plate body 4, drive bird ware 7 and utilize the reflector to dazzle dazzling light and drive bird, blow simultaneously and move when driving bird ware 7, drive bird ware 7 and can take place to rotate, drive the reflector of bird ware 7 and can take place to rotate along with driving bird ware, improve and drive bird ware result of use.
In this embodiment, the lifting rope 8 is provided with outward and prevents twining pipe 9, prevents twining pipe 9 and is hollow form, prevents twining pipe 9 cover and just its top connection and drives bird plate body 4 outside lifting rope 8, prevents twining the length of pipe 9 and is less than the length of lifting rope 8, prevents twining pipe 9 and can drive bird ware 7 when wind blows, avoids a plurality of lifting ropes 8 intertwine that drive bird ware 7 and lead to driving the poor problem of bird effect, prevents twining the length of pipe 9 and is less than the length of lifting rope 8, lifting rope 8 can be moved by a small margin when wind blows.
Example 2: referring to fig. 2, the metal sounding body 5 is disposed outside the connection tube 42, the metal sounding body 5 includes a sounding body 51 and a sound amplifying stage 52, the sounding body 51 is disposed outside the connection tube 42 and has an echo cavity, on which the sound amplifying stage 52 is disposed; bird ball 6 is located bird repellent 7 one side and its close to metal sounding body 5, bird ball 6 is the metal ball, be connected with lifting rope 8 on it, and lifting rope 8 keeps away from the free end of bird ball 6 and connects bird plate body 4, the great state that can keep the rope of bird ball 6 is straight, so needn't set up anti-twine pipe 9 on the lifting rope 8 here, bird ball 6 strikes sounding body 51 when receiving wind to blow, sounding body 51 sends the sound that makes birds frightened and outwards spreads by public address platform 52, bird public address platform 52 can enlarge the sound that sounding body 51 sent, improve and drive the bird effect, and bird ball 6 is the metal ball, it has higher hardness, compared with adopting pottery or glass to have the not fragile advantage of intensity height of sound production, long service life.
In this embodiment, the sounding body 51 is made of a copper material, and the copper material has better corrosion resistance and has the advantage of good sounding effect.
Example 3: referring to fig. 3, the spiral tube 10 is wound outside the antenna body 2, the spiral tube 10 is provided with an air outlet communicated with the inner cavity of the spiral tube 10, the air outlet is opposite to the antenna body 2, one end of the spiral tube 10 is closed, and the other end of the spiral tube is provided with a connector 101; the outside of the connecting pipe 42 is provided with a hot air box 11 matched with the spiral pipe 10, the hot air box 11 is fixed at one side of the connecting pipe 42 through a mounting plate, the output end of the hot air box 11 is connected with a pipeline 111, and the end of the pipe 111 close to the connector 101 is provided with a connecting seat 112 connected and matched with the connector 101, the hot air box 11 is electrically connected with a controller, the hot air box 11 outputs hot air, the hot air is output to the spiral pipe 10 through the pipe 111 and is output through an air outlet on the spiral pipe 10, when the antenna is covered by snow, the snow on the antenna can be melted by the hot air output by the hot air hole, the snow load of the antenna is reduced, so that the base station antenna can not have accidents in snowy weather, the use safety of the base station antenna is improved, moreover, the helix tube 10 (which is made of non-metal plastic tube) is not entirely sleeved outside the antenna, but only partially sleeved on the top of the antenna, so that the communication is not influenced.
The utility model discloses an antenna structure adopts bird repeller 7 and bird repelling ball 6 two kinds of modes to drive bird work, utilizes bird repeller 7, bird repelling ball 6 to drive the bird by the action that wind blows, avoids the bird to stop and nest around the antenna, avoids its activity to influence the antenna function, simple structure does not need external supply power to work, and the advantage that has difficult winding and need not power drive compared with the tradition adopts ribbon, electricity to drive the bird device is worth widelys popularization; the spiral pipe 10 and the hot-blast case 11 cooperation that set up simultaneously can be when the antenna is covered by snow, and the snow on the antenna can be melted by the hot-blast of hot-blast hole output, reduces the snow load of antenna, improves the work safety nature.
